    Nurse Practitioner- **$7,500 Sign On Bonus**

    Trusted Medical, PLLC  

     About us  

     Trusted Medical, PLLC is the clinical care delivery affiliate of Edera (www.edera.com). We specialize in serving Veterans by reducing wait times for them to gain access to disability screens and separation health assessments required by the Veteran Affairs (VA) to receive benefits. Help serve those who have served us by joining our growing team!  

    In addition to our core work with the VA, Trusted Medical holds multiple government contracts nationwide, allowing our providers to also participate in occupational health services for their applicants and employees. This includes pre-employment screenings, fitness-for-duty evaluations, and other health assessments that support a wide range of government agencies. 

    Job Description  

    This role supports the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s in conducting assessments for Veterans leaving military service or applying for disability benefits from the VA.

    The Advanced Practice Provider will perform face-to-face, in-clinic assessments/evaluations with Veterans to complete the required Disability Benefits Questionnaire (DBQ) for submission to VA for eligibility determination. DBQs include questions that require a direct clinical exam of the Veteran (e.g., testing range of motion of joints, documentation of crepitus, etc.).

    In addition to VA-related assessments, this role includes providing occupational health services for various government departments and agencies. These services may include:

    • Pre-employment physicals
    • Department of Transportation (DOT) exams
    • Fitness-for-duty evaluations
    • Other occupational health screenings as required by federal contracts

    This role requires excellent and expeditious assessment skills. Ideal candidates should have a proven track record of high reliability when working in an independent atmosphere with little oversight.
